Third shooting in Delhi protests in four days Eyewitnesses who chased gunmen on Sunday night say incitement by ministers and other leaders is having an effect on Hindutva foot soldiers u2018 Shooters arrived just after cops leftu2019 Protesters gather outside Jamia Nagar police station demanding action against the shooters, late on Sunday night. PIC/ Shash wat Das Gaurav Sarkar gaurav. sarkar@ mid- day. com RECOUNTING Sunday nightu2019s shooting at Jamia Millia Islamia University during an anti- CAA protest, students told mid- day how they ran after the shooters but they managed to flee because the barricade, which the police put up every night, was surprisingly missing.

The students keep a check on security at the barricades... The police have not been deployed to enforce safety in the areau2019 Shashwat Das, Indraprastha University student u2018 The statements about using bullets have had an effect. [ Shooters] get the courage from leaders who encourage such behaviour.
